u/Sayakor0 '09 Coupe 2.5S 7d ago

 Yeah it seems the 5th generation only had the cap rather than a dipstick.

 Since it's missing anyway, you could just opt for a dipstick so you're able to check your fluid level later. The dipstick serves as a cap as well, so no loss there.

 The part number for the dipstick is 31086-JA00A. 

 If you just want the cap like how it was from factory, the part number for that should be 31086-3TA1A.
